Abstract
•Carbon dots (CDs) with fluorescence quantum yield of 58% were prepared by hydrothermal method.•Tryptophan was selected as CDs precursor after screening from seventeen amino acids.•The CDs can be used for both one- and two-photon fluorescence cellular imaging.•The CDs conjugating with TAT peptide showed good capability in nuclear-targeted imaging.
